**Capacity note: the great FD hunt (Saltmarsh gateway)**

Heads up for the security review: while chasing leaked file descriptors in the Saltmarsh gateway, we discovered the leak scales with TLS renegotiation attempts, so an attacker could plausibly exhaust descriptors faster than our reaper reclaims them. We've sized headroom assuming the worst observed churn from the Drayton load tests, doubled, plus a hard per-peer connection cap. Sanity-check our math against these assumptions — the chosen limits and reaper intervals are listed below.

tuning constants:
QUOTAS = {
    "druwyn": 5,
    "holix": 5,
    "zorath": 5,
    "holwyn": 10,
}

## Formula sandbox tuning

User-supplied formulas in Gridmoor execute inside a restricted interpreter with hard ceilings on time, memory, and call depth. Reviewers should confirm any change to these ceilings is justified in the PR description, since raising them widens the abuse surface. Defaults were chosen from production traces. The current limits are as follows.

limits module of tafog-fawip:
WEIGHTS = {
    "julix": 57,
    "lamys": 992,
    "kasvan": 209,
    "quenok": 750,
    "alddor": 259,
    "oliath": 1009,
    "wenix": 815,
}

Our supply agreement with Kelstrand Components expires at quarter-end. Kelstrand has proposed a three-year renewal with a 6% price uplift, offset by improved lead times from their Varnholt facility. Alternatives were benchmarked: two credible options, both requiring six-month qualification. Operations recommends renewal with a volume-based rebate clause; procurement concurs, subject to tightened quality penalties. Please review the attached comparison grid before the session. The negotiating position we intend to take is set out below.

internal memo for kawip-hadug: Headcount on the Wenwyn team goes from 7 to 140 by the end of January. Gross margin on Wenwyn came in at 20 percent against a plan of 15 percent.

## Authentication

The SQLint-Prairie hook runs on every merge to release branches. Rules live in `lint/sql/`. CI rejects unformatted DDL. To trigger a manual lint pass against the Oakmere release pipeline, call the runner endpoint directly. Requests must include the bearer token shown below.

login token, kagaf-bawig: eyJhbGciOiJIUzI1NiIsInR5cCI6IkpXVCJ9.eyJzdWIiOiI1b8bmcIn0.xjc0uBP3